← 返回
AI智能 Key

Langextract Search

集成智谱搜索、DuckDuckGo 搜索和多模型结构化提取的完整工作流。
集成智谱搜索、DuckDuckGo 搜索和多模型结构化提取的完整工作流。
luw2007
AI智能 clawhub v0.1.5 1 版本 99863.8 Key: 需要
★ 0
Stars
📥 733
下载
💾 26
安装
1
版本
#latest

概述

LangExtract Search Skill

集成智谱搜索 + DuckDuckGo 搜索 + 多模型结构化提取的完整工作流。

功能特性

  • 🔍 智谱 AI 搜索: 使用智谱 zai-sdk 进行网络搜索
  • 🌐 DuckDuckGo 搜索: 备用搜索引擎(支持多后端:Bing/Google/Brave 等)
  • 📝 多模型提取: 支持 OpenAI 通用协议
  • 🔄 完整工作流: 搜索 → 提取 → 保存,一键完成
  • ⚙️ 灵活配置: 支持时间过滤、地区设置、代理等高级参数

前置条件

  1. Python 3.8+
  2. ddgs(DuckDuckGo 搜索库)
  3. requests(HTTP 请求库)
  4. 可选:配置 langextract 处理模型

安装

pip install requests ddgs langextract

参考 conf.json.example 配置模型

首次使用交互选择

如果未在 openclaw.json 中配置 baseUrl,首次运行时会自动提示选择套餐类型,选择结果保存到项目 conf.json 文件中。

快速开始

cd scripts
python search.py "搜索关键词" --verbose

使用方法

基本用法

python search.py "搜索关键词"

验证输入输出(详细模式)

python search.py "搜索关键词" --verbose

保存完整 JSON

python search.py "搜索关键词" --save-json

自定义 DuckDuckGo 结果数量

python search.py "搜索关键词" --ddg-max-results 30

所有选项

python search.py --help

搜索配置

搜索参数通过 conf.json 配置。默认配置开箱即用,无需额外设置。

默认配置(自动应用)

搜索引擎默认结果数时间过滤其他
-------------------------------------------
智谱搜索15 条不限search_pro 引擎
DuckDuckGo20 条不限自动选择后端

自定义配置

当默认配置不满足需求时(如需要时间过滤、地区设置、代理等),请参阅 references/search-params.md 获取完整参数说明。

常见自定义场景:

  • 搜索最近一周/一月的内容:设置 timelimit: "week""month"
  • 限定搜索地区:设置 region: "cn-zh""us-en"
  • 使用代理访问:设置 proxy: "http://127.0.0.1:7890"
  • 切换搜索后端:设置 backend: "google""bing,google"

更多信息

工作流详细说明、输出文件格式和故障排除,请参阅 references/workflow-details.md

版本历史

共 1 个版本

  • v0.1.5 当前
    2026-03-29 14:07 安全 安全

安全检测

腾讯云安全 (Keen)

安全,无风险
查看报告

腾讯云安全 (Sanbu)

安全,无风险
查看报告

🔗 相关推荐

ai-intelligence

Proactive Agent

halthelobster
将AI智能体从任务执行者升级为主动预判需求、持续优化的智能伙伴。集成WAL协议、工作缓冲区、自主定时任务及实战验证模式。Hal Stack核心组件 🦞
★ 835 📥 213,059
developer-tools

RTK Rewrite

luw2007
RTK 重写插件,专为 OpenClaw 设计,拦截 exec 工具调用并交由 rtk rewrite 重写,以减少 token 使用量,保持命令意图。
★ 0 📥 850
ai-intelligence

Self-Improving + Proactive Agent

ivangdavila
自我反思+自我批评+自我学习+自组织记忆。智能体评估自身工作、发现错误并持续改进。
★ 1,357 📥 318,190